    A lot of overreaction about the weigh in here. Conor is never going to look great weighing in at 145, but for me that's the best he's looked at weigh in since the Poirier fight. While it's still not great, and that's a sign why he's looking to move up soon, he's definitely looked worse. He was smiling a lot and even sounded better on the mic than after the 189 weigh in.

    Aldo wasn't quite as bad, but was still very sucked in yet there's not many worrying about him. It can't be good on the body but it was hardly a surprise they were going to look gaunt.
